Terraform通过状态文件管理基础设施变更,支持本地和远程后端配置。远程后端如AWS S3、Azure Blob和GCP可实现团队协作、版本控制和状态锁定,确保状态文件安全存储和便捷访问,从而提高基础设施的可靠性和安全性。
Terraform状态管理对可靠和可扩展的基础设施至关重要。使用远程后端存储状态文件、创建特定环境的状态文件,并启用状态文件锁定,以避免冲突和降低部署风险。
Terraform 是一种重要的基础设施即代码工具,其状态文件记录当前基础设施状态。使用本地存储状态文件有数据丢失和协作问题。AWS S3 作为远程后端提供安全的解决方案,并结合 DynamoDB 实现状态锁定,防止并发修改。本文介绍如何配置 S3 和 DynamoDB,确保状态安全和一致性。
完成下面两步后,将自动完成登录并继续当前操作。